This hike to the Radau Waterfall offers variety and a surprising refreshment at the sulfur spring.

We start our hike at the "HarzWaldHaus" at the Kurpark and walk through the Cold Valley to the climbing garden. Here we can put our skills to the test and prepare ourselves for the route ahead. Continuing along the Philosopher's Path, we get a good view of the gabbro quarry on the other side of the valley. Finally, we reach the Radau Waterfall and enjoy a short break in a beautiful setting. Next, we head to the sulfur spring where we can refresh ourselves. Via the Lohnbach ascent, the lower Winterberg slope path, and the Rudolfklippe ascent, we reach the Molkenhaus. Here we can rest in an idyllic location before descending again via the Ettersklippe and hiking back to the Kurpark.
